Mistakes to Avoid
Bad: Show the Cursor diagram verbatim and claim it as your own work.
Good: Acknowledge the AI assistance, then walk the panel through each layer, highlighting why you would keep or discard it.
Bad: Cite generic scalability concepts like “horizontal scaling” without tying them to Meta’s product numbers.
Good: Reference Meta‑specific data—e.g., “Our target is 100 ms latency for 2 billion daily queries on the Ads bidding service.”
Bad: Spend the entire interview time reproducing the AI output.
Good: Use the AI diagram as a launchpad, then quickly pivot to a custom trade‑off analysis that fits the 45‑minute window.
